The Benefits and Challenges of Using AMS 4928 Titanium in Modern Engineering

Introduction

Titanium alloys, specifically AMS 4928, have become essential materials in the world of engineering. Its unique properties offer an exceptional balance between strength, lightness, and durability, making it a top choice for applications that demand high performance. However, working with AMS 4928 presents both advantages and challenges for engineers and manufacturers. Let’s dive into the key benefits and some of the challenges that come with using this advanced material.

Benefits of AMS 4928 Titanium

Exceptional Strength and Durability
AMS 4928 titanium boasts an incredible tensile strength that allows it to perform well under high-stress conditions. The alloy’s ability to maintain its structural integrity under extreme mechanical loads makes it a reliable choice for the aerospace sector. Components such as jet engine parts, landing gear, and structural components are often made from AMS 4928 due to these characteristics.


Corrosion Resistance
One of the hallmark properties of titanium alloys, including AMS 4928, is their excellent resistance to corrosion. Titanium is highly resistant to oxidation, even in aggressive environments like seawater, chemicals, and acids. Challenges of AMS 4928 Titanium

Machining Difficulties
While AMS 4928 is a durable material, it can be challenging to machine. Titanium alloys are known for being more difficult to work with compared to other metals like aluminum or steel. The material's high strength can cause tools to wear down faster, requiring specialized machining techniques to achieve the desired shapes and tolerances.


Cost and Availability
The production and processing of titanium alloys, including AMS 4928, can be costly. Titanium is more expensive than many other metals due to the complex extraction and refining processes. As a result, projects that require significant quantities of AMS 4928 may experience higher material costs. Additionally, titanium’s availability can sometimes be limited, depending on global supply chains.


Welding Challenges
Although AMS 4928 can be welded, it requires specific techniques and expertise to ensure a high-quality bond. Improper welding methods can lead to issues such as contamination or structural weaknesses in the weld, which can undermine the performance of the final product. Specialized equipment and skilled technicians are required to weld AMS 4928 properly.

What steps will be taken for titanium tube repair welding?

Repair welding of titanium tube is a method of repairing titanium tube (titanium alloy tube). Titanium tubes are usually used in aerospace, shipbuilding, chemical industry and other fields. They are widely used because of their excellent corrosion resistance, high strength and low density. Next, the titanium tube manufacturer summarizes what steps will be taken for titanium tube repair welding?

When repairing titanium tubes, the following steps are usually taken for repair welding:

1. Preparation: Clean and prepare the surface of the titanium tube to be repaired to ensure that the surface is clean and free of impurities.

3. Repair welding: According to the actual situation, weld and repair the parts that need to be repaired to ensure the welding quality and welding strength.

4. Post-weld treatment: Perform necessary heat treatment and surface treatment on the weld to achieve the required performance requirements.

When repairing titanium tubes, special attention should be paid to controlling parameters such as welding temperature, welding atmosphere, and welding speed to ensure welding quality, avoid welding defects, and affect the performance of titanium tubes. Titanium tube: a good pipe in the field of corrosion resistance

Among many pipes, titanium tube stands out for its advantages, especially in terms of corrosion resistance. Titanium tube has good corrosion resistance and good resistance to most chemicals such as acids, alkalis, salts, etc. It performs well in harsh corrosive environments such as marine environments and chemical environments, has a long service life, and has become an ideal pipe choice for many special working conditions.

The good corrosion resistance of titanium tubes comes from its own chemical properties. Titanium reacts easily with oxygen in the air and quickly forms a dense and stable oxide film on the surface. This oxide film is like a solid armor, tightly attached to the surface of the titanium tube, preventing the internal titanium from further contact with the external corrosive medium. In the chemical environment, there are often various strong acids, strong alkalis and other highly corrosive chemicals. In the marine environment, high salinity, high humidity and the presence of various microorganisms in seawater have a very strong corrosive effect on the pipe. Titanium tubes can work stably in such harsh environments, and will not suffer from serious corrosion after long-term use. Whether it is used in seawater pipelines in marine engineering or related facilities on offshore oil platforms, titanium tubes have shown strong corrosion resistance, greatly reducing maintenance and replacement costs.

In addition, due to the corrosion resistance of titanium tubes, it is not easy to be damaged by corrosion during long-term use, so it has a long service life, providing reliable protection for engineering projects.
